Hi All,
Does anyone have any idea on how to import and scale correctly campus, building and floor diagrams into Cisco PI?
I have tried several times via the editor to rescale and it just doesn't work.
Any advise would be greatly appreciated.
Thanks in advance for any replies.
Jason

06-26-2013 03:22 AM
From my experience the map editor doesn't rescale maps very well. I've found that editing the floor to the correct size and then importing the map gives me the correct sized floor area.

06-26-2013 07:29 AM
Jason:
Thanks to bugs like CSCug78551, yes, this kind of thing didn't work so well in earlier versions, but should be resolved in the new patch for Prime Infrastructure 1.3.0.20, filename PI_1.3.0.20_Update_1-12.tar.gz. Prime Infrastructure 1.3.0.20 introduced the Offset Correction Tool in the dropdown list on a floor; the Update_1-12 patch made it work better.
